Under GDPR British Airways (BA) Could be Fined £500M ($650)

So BA has been hacked and customer credit card details are put online.

The attack is the first to hit a company under the new GDPR regulations, the fine which can be up to 4% of turnover would be about £500m ($650m).

BA did report the data breach in the 72 hours as required by it will be interesting to see what the regulators do!
